Property Details for 13 York St, Brighton

13 York St, Brighton is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om House and was built in 1915. The property has a land size of 199m2 and floor size of 105m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in May 2021.

About Brighton 3186

The size of Brighton is approximately 8.4 square kilometres. It has 22 parks covering nearly 10.9% of total area. The population of Brighton in 2016 was 23253 people. By 2021 the population was 23252 showing a stable population in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Brighton is 50-59 years. Households in Brighton are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Brighton work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 73.20% of the homes in Brighton were owner-occupied compared with 72.10% in 2016.

Brighton has 14,241 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Brighton have seen a 9.78%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 12.90% increase. As at 31 December 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Brighton is $3,251,100 while the median value for Units is $1,190,295.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,390 while Units have a median rent of $750.
There are currently 27 properties listed for sale, and 10 properties listed for rent in Brighton on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 706 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Brighton.
